Output 68e4a290e206e83a3fbce7df4bc40c2b9b05618f8ac4a0424acf934c09b48041:0

value
3116236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 277448892a76097dbab12529ef1c96858fe83e8a OP_EQUAL
address
35HdaXtnwuhVmgFph1H5JGGZV5zXbnNshD
transaction
68e4a290e206e83a3fbce7df4bc40c2b9b05618f8ac4a0424acf934c09b48041
spent
true